webpack-dev-server可以监视更改并在iisexpress的文件系统上写入吗?

时间:2018-05-04 09:23:42

标签: javascript iis webpack vue.js devops

一个很棒的ASP.NET MVC应用程序:80。用vue写的部分内容。目前我们正在运行手册" npm run build"每次改变后。这花了太长时间。

webpack-dev-server似乎是完美的解决方案。它在内存中监视变化和缓存!但它会与iisexpress发生冲突。 There are no easy solutions making them work together.

我想我有一个更好的主意:

  1. 开始工作" npm run start" 为" ./ src / vue /&#设置vue部分的webpack-dev-server 34 ;.提供所有" localhost:8080 / dist / bundle。[chunk] .js"。

  2. 在" ./ src / vue /"中的任何文件中进行更改时;在保存" npm运行刷新" 正在运行。一个小脚本,请求所有块" localhost:8080 / dist /。[chunk] .js"和地点在" ./ dist /"。

  3. 开发人员F5我们的ASP.NET MVC应用程序和iisexpress提供更新的" ./ dist /"。

  4. 我的问题是如何从webpack-dev-server轻松地为.js和.css文件请求所有块?

    我必须写出第一个" npm run start"的输出。到一个配置文件,然后由" npm run refresh"读取。这甚至合理吗?我希望webpack-dev-server可以写入文件系统本身。

    热模块重新加载会很好,但ASP应用程序是一堆乱七八糟的iframe。目前只是尝试让我们的构建过程更快一些。

    由于

1 个答案:

答案 0 :(得分:0)

如果有人发现这个帖子:

答案是使用webpack --watch!完全是我所描述的,没有混乱。

https://webpack.js.org/configuration/watch/